Got my OS .18 for $135.00 short shaft with pull starter. It is every bit as good as my RB S7II as far as quality, and ease of tune. Runs clean all the time and once set requires very little adjustment if any. Really noticable is the mid range torque.
Outstanding performance in a rc10 gt.
